首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 Builder >

获取键盘消息有关问题

2013-08-01 
求助获取键盘消息问题我想实现,在任意窗口输入键盘消息,在指定的edit下显示,如何利用全局键盘钩子实现?尽

求助获取键盘消息问题
我想实现,在任意窗口输入键盘消息,在指定的edit下显示,如何利用全局键盘钩子实现?尽量展示代码!!

再加个判断避免打印两次vkCode好看点
if (key->flags == LLKHF_UP)
    Form1->Edit1->Text = key->vkCode;
[解决办法]
你要的是全局钩子,用啥dll啊,又不是钩特定进程。
你那代码,得在每个函数前表面__stdcall,比如
LRESULT __stdcall CALLBACK KeyHookProc(int nCode, WPARAM wParam, LPARAM lParam);

热点排行